About the Role

Parsons Corporation is seeking a Senior Quantity Surveyor with a specialization in MEP (Mechanical, Electrical, and Plumbing) to join our team in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ia. This role is central to providing comprehensive commercial and contractual advisory services. The position requires a strong focus on post-contract claims management, detailed quantum analysis, and thorough Extension of Time (EOT) assessments. The successful candidate will leverage a strong technical understanding and proven experience in managing multi-disciplinary works, including civil structures, architectural elements, transport systems, and MEP installations, to accurately evaluate cost and delay impacts on major projects.

At Parsons, we cultivate an environment that encourages innovation, collaboration with skilled professionals, and individual contribution. Our leadership is committed to valuing people, embracing agility, and fostering growth, enabling employees to reach their full potential.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ide expert advice on contractual entitlement, risk allocation, and the interpretation of contract provisions, particularly under FIDIC and similar forms of contract.
  • Assess, prepare, and respond to claims submissions, ensuring the inclusion of detailed narratives and comprehensive supporting documentation.
  • Maintain and manage a thorough claims register, meticulously tracking the status, key milestones, and outcomes of all claims.
  • Draft clear, concise, and effective contractual correspondence, including formal notices, responses, and determinations.
  • Identify and evaluate interface risks across civil, structural, architectural, transport systems, and MEP packages.
  • Develop robust claims defense strategies and provide essential support during negotiations, settlements, and dispute resolution proceedings.
  • Perform forensic quantum analysis, covering detailed cost evaluation, prolongation, disruption, and associated financial impacts.
  • Validate contractor submissions against measured works, procurement data, and subcontractor accounts to ensure accuracy.
  • Prepare independent, evidence-based quantum reports suitable for formal dispute resolution processes.
  • Undertake detailed Extension of Time (EOT) assessments, including critical path analysis and delay substantiation.
  • Review and challenge delay analyses, assessing concurrency, dependencies, and mitigation measures in close collaboration with planning teams.
  • Deliver clear and robust delay assessments that are directly aligned with associated cost implications.
  • Provide strategic commercial advice aimed at mitigating risks and optimizing overall project outcomes.
  • Conduct comprehensive contract audits and commercial reviews across multiple work packages.
  • Support dispute avoidance initiatives and contribute to early-stage claim resolution strategies.
  • Assist in the preparation of expert reports and provide critical commercial input to legal teams and independent experts.
  • Compile, review, and analyze project records, progress data, and technical documentation to support commercial and contractual assessments.
  • Prepare and manage cost estimates, cost plans, and revisions in accordance with design and scope changes.
  • Establish and maintain effective cost control, monitoring, and reporting systems, including periodic forecasting.
  • Develop and maintain cost databases and benchmark rates for accurate project costing.
  • Assess the value of completed works and administer interim payment applications and certifications.
  • Review and assess variation submissions in strict accordance with contractual and commercial requirements.
  • Liaise effectively with clients, consultants, contractors, and subcontractors on all commercial and contractual matters.
  • Negotiate and agree final accounts, ensuring fair, accurate, and commercially sound outcomes.

About the Role

Chestertons MENA is expanding its Building Consultancy & Project Management team and is seeking a highly experienced Senior Cost Control Manager to join their dynamic operations in Saudi Arabia. This role is crucial for ensuring the financial success and strategic alignment of various construction projects within the Kingdom. The Senior Cost Control Manager will play a pivotal role in managing project finances from inception through to completion, providing expert financial guidance and robust cost control measures. This position offers a challenging and rewarding opportunity for a seasoned professional looking to make a significant impact in the Saudi Arabian construction market.

Key Responsibilities

  • Prepare preliminary budgets, cost plans, benchmark studies, and financial feasibility evaluations during the early stages of projects.
  • Develop comprehensive project budgets considering market conditions, contractor pricing trends, procurement strategies, and construction methodologies.
  • Review design developments and assess their financial implications on overall project budgets and delivery strategies.
  • Develop and maintain detailed project cost reports, cash flow forecasts, cost trackers, and commercial reporting systems across multiple projects.
  • Monitor project expenditures, commitments, variations, claims, and forecast final project costs against approved budgets.
  • Support tendering activities, including Bill of Quantities (BOQ) reviews, commercial comparisons, tender analysis, and contractor evaluations.
  • Challenge unrealistic consultant estimates and provide commercially grounded recommendations to management teams.
  • Proactively identify cost risks and support value engineering initiatives without compromising project quality or operational objectives.
  • Benchmark project costs against comparable hospitality, fit-out, and mixed-use developments within the Saudi market.
  • Coordinate with Design Managers, Project Managers, planners, consultants, contractors, and procurement teams to ensure alignment between scope, cost, and program.
  • Prepare executive-level financial reports, dashboards, and cost summaries for management and Board presentations.
  • Review contractor payment applications, variation submissions, and commercial proposals.
  • Support the establishment of cost control procedures, governance systems, and reporting standards across all projects.
  • Support project close-out activities, including final account reviews, commercial reconciliation, and final cost reporting.
